Did you buy this S7/S7 Edge new recently or is it a used phone. The S7/S7 Edge is almost a 2 y/o phone even if you did purchase it new recently. If you purchased it new recently, I would certainly look at the apps you have on the device. It looks like you may have a rogue app which is draining the battery.
